** The Subaru repair market servicing Kell, IL, is effectively centered in the Bloomington-Normal area, approximately a 15-20 minute drive away. The market is characterized by healthy competition between the local Subaru dealership and several highly competent independent specialists. The independent shops have a strong market presence by offering significant cost savings over the dealer (typically 20-30% on labor) while often providing more personalized service and deeper enthusiast knowledge, especially for older or performance models. The average quality of Subaru-specific service is high, as the prevalence of Subarus in the region has fostered expert-level talent. Pricing for common repairs is competitive; a standard head gasket replacement on a non-turbo engine typically ranges from $2,200-$2,800, while a CVT fluid service is generally $250-$350. For specialized services like EyeSight calibration, which requires proprietary targets and alignment racks, prices are more standardized across providers, usually between $400-$600.
